The sixth generation fighter is no longer just a futuristic concept—it represents a fundamental shift in how air warfare could be conducted. Unlike traditional fighter jets, these aircraft are being designed as part of an interconnected combat network, combining advanced stealth, artificial intelligence, powerful sensors, autonomous systems, and unmanned aircraft.

One of the most fascinating ideas is the concept of manned-unmanned teaming. A future pilot may not operate alone. Instead, a single fighter could coordinate with multiple autonomous “loyal wingman” aircraft, allowing the team to detect threats, gather intelligence, and perform different missions simultaneously.

Another major breakthrough is next-generation sensor fusion. Instead of forcing pilots to interpret information from dozens of separate systems, advanced software could combine radar, infrared, electronic warfare, satellite, and other battlefield data into a unified picture. The goal is simple: give pilots better information and more time to make critical decisions.
